我的 Ubuntu 版本是 12.04 LTS。我写了一些 C 程序。但是有一个编译器问题。我在 Google 上搜索后发现我需要 build-essential。所以我下载并安装了它。
安装后,运行良好。但大约 3 小时后,问题再次出现。
当我写下:
gcc -o -std=c99 sort sort.c
编译器抱怨:
gcc: error: sort: No such file or directory.
我现在不知道。
答案1
以下步骤将解决您的问题:
gcc -std=c99 sort.c -o sort
您的命令告诉 gcc 编译一个名为 sort 的文件,但该文件不存在,因此出现错误消息。-o 标志后面需要跟输出名称,但您的行后面跟的是 -std=c99,这是不正确的。